Understanding the Role of Braking Pads in Vehicle Safety
The braking pads are vital components within the disc brake system. They are designed to press against the brake discs (also known as rotors) to generate the friction necessary to slow down or stop the vehicle. When the driver applies the brake pedal, hydraulic pressure activates the brake calipers, which then squeeze the braking pads against the rotors. This friction converts the vehicle's kinetic energy into heat, effectively reducing speed.
A well-functioning set of braking pads ensures consistent, reliable stopping power, preventing accidents and ensuring driver and passenger safety. Conversely, deteriorated or incompatible pads can lead to compromised braking performance, increased stopping distances, and potential safety hazards. Hence, selecting the right braking pads and maintaining them properly is indispensable for every vehicle owner.
Types of Braking Pads: An Overview of Materials and Designs
The effectiveness of braking pads depends heavily on their material composition and design. Below are the most common types, each tailored for specific driving needs and vehicle types:
- Semi-Metallic Braking Pads: These pads contain a blend of metals such as copper, steel, or iron mixed with a bound compound. They are renowned for high durability, excellent heat dissipation, and reliable performance under extreme conditions, making them ideal for heavy-duty applications and high-performance vehicles.
- Sintered Brake Pads: A subtype of semi-metallic pads, sintered pads are manufactured through a process of sintering metal powders at high temperatures, resulting in highly resilient, heat-resistant pads with superior stopping power. They excel in wet conditions and prolonged driving scenarios.
- Organic (Non-Asbestos Organic – NAO) Brake Pads: Comprising materials like rubber, glass, Kevlar, and resins, these pads provide smooth braking and minimal noise. They are generally quieter and gentler on rotors but tend to wear faster and produce more dust compared to metallic options.
- Low-Metallic and Ceramic Brake Pads: These advanced materials offer a balance between performance and comfort. Ceramic pads, in particular, produce less dust, operate quietly, and have excellent stability at various temperatures, making them a popular choice for everyday vehicles.
How to Choose the Right Braking Pads for Your Vehicle
Selecting the appropriate braking pads involves considering several factors to ensure optimal performance, safety, and longevity:
- Vehicle Type and Usage: Heavy-duty trucks or high-performance sports cars require different pads than compact city vehicles. For frequent city driving with lots of stops, organic or ceramic pads might be preferable, while for towing or racing, metallic or sintered options are more suitable.
- Driving Conditions: If you often drive in wet or hilly terrain, choose pads that perform well under these circumstances, such as sintered or semi-metallic pads.
- Budget and Longevity: While metallic pads may be more expensive initially, their durability often offsets the cost over time. Organic pads tend to be cheaper but wear out more quickly.
- Compatibility: Always consult your vehicle manufacturer’s specifications to ensure compatibility with your make and model, especially regarding size and thermal ratings.

The Installation Process of Braking Pads: What Every Vehicle Owner Needs to Know
Proper installation of braking pads is critical for ensuring optimal performance and safety. While professional installation is recommended for most, understanding the basic steps can help you monitor your brake system:
- Preparation: Gather necessary tools, including jack stands, a wrench set, brake caliper piston compressors, and new braking pads.
- Vehicle Lift and Safety: Carefully lift the vehicle and secure it with wheel chocks to prevent accidents.
- Removal of Old Pads: Remove the wheel, caliper bolts, and then carefully take out the current brake pads. Inspect the rotor surface for damage or uneven wear.
- Caliper Piston Compression: Use a piston compressor tool to retract the caliper pistons, making space for the new pads.
- Installation of New Braking Pads: Place the new braking pads into the caliper, ensuring correct orientation and fit.
- Reassembly and Testing: Reattach the caliper, replace the wheel, and carefully lower the vehicle. Test the brakes at low speed to ensure proper engagement.
Always follow the manufacturer’s specific instructions when replacing braking pads to prevent uneven wear, noise, or compromised safety.
Maintenance Tips for Maximizing Brake Pad Life
Proper maintenance extends the lifespan of your braking pads and ensures consistent, safe braking performance:
- Regular Inspection: Check your brake pads for thickness; replace them if the friction material is below the recommended minimum (typically 3mm).
- Brake Fluid Checks: Maintaining proper brake fluid levels keeps hydraulic pressure consistent, preventing uneven pad wear.
- Driving Habits: Avoid aggressive braking whenever possible and try to anticipate stops to reduce unnecessary wear.
- Rotor Maintenance: Keep rotors clean and smooth. Resurface or replace rotors as needed to prevent uneven pad wear.
- Cleanliness: Clean your brake system regularly to prevent dust and debris buildup, which can accelerate wear and cause noise.
Innovations in Brake Pad Technology and Future Trends
The landscape of braking pads continues to evolve with technological advances aimed at improving safety, performance, and environmental impact. Recent innovations include:
- Low-Dust and Low-Noise Pads: Designed with advanced composite materials to produce minimal brake dust and operate quietly.
- Eco-Friendly Materials: Development of greener manufacturing processes and biodegradable components to reduce environmental impact.
- Smart Brake Pads: Integration with sensors and electronic systems to monitor pad wear and alert drivers proactively.
- High-Performance Materials: Use of carbon composites and other exotic materials for ultimate thermal stability and maximum stopping power, especially vital in racing and performance vehicles.
Staying informed about these trends can help you choose braking pads that meet your needs today and in the future.
